Bryant and Perron Earn All-Region Recognition

The junior duo of Andrew Bryant and DJ Perron of the University of Massachusetts Dartmouth baseball team have earned All-Region recognition after their stellar 2022 campaign. Bryant was named to the First Team by the American Baseball Coaches Association (ABCA) and tabbed to the Second Team by D3baseball.com, while Perron earned Third-Team honors from the ABCA.

ANDREW BRYANT - ABCA FIRST TEAM ALL-REGION & D3BASEBALL.COM SECOND TEAM

Bryant had one of the best seasons in the region and was noticed by both the ABCA and D3baseball.com. The Canton, Mass. native led the Corsairs with a .415 batting average and was tied for the most home runs in the Little East Conference (LEC) following the LEC Tournament with 11. Bryant bolstered his impressive resume with 34 RBI, 34 runs scored, a .680 slugging percentage, and a .482 on-base percentage. A two-time LEC Player of the Week, Bryant crushed two home runs in the season opening series at Farmingdale State (2/27) and kept up that pace all year. Bryant went on a 24-game hitting streak beginning at Wheaton College on March 27 and delivered every game up to the LEC semifinal round against UMass Boston on May 13. A Canton, Mass. native, Bryant's second Player of the Week honor came on May 9 after going 9-for-15 for a .600 batting average with two home runs, four RBI, and eight runs scored with a double for the week, including a 5-for-5 performance at the plate at Keene State.

DJ PERRON - ABCA THIRD TEAM ALL-REGION

A two-time All-Conference award winner, Perron picks up his first All-Region honor. From Swansea, Mass., Perron hit .366 and led the Corsairs with 50 RBI, 13 doubles, and three triples. He finished second on the team with nine home runs, 30 runs scored, a .671 slugging percentage, and a .407 on-base percentage. Perron's power came alive late in the season, he hit five of his nine home runs in the final eight games of the season, including three in the LEC Tournament to lead UMass Dartmouth to the championship game.
